多数工程机械为了提高工作性能和本身的稳定性,均设有支腿油缸。挖掘机设有两个或四个支腿,汽车起重机一般设有四个支腿。当起重机作业时,载荷及自重完全由四个支腿支撑。因此要求支腿油缸工作可靠,否则会引起起重机倾翻。在使用维修中,我们发现QY8A型液压起重机的蛙式支腿因油缸的活塞挡板弯曲变形,发生“软腿”的现象较多,日本多田野10吨液压汽车起重机也曾出现过类似情况。
